Incident Overview
A motor vehicle incident on southbound Interstate 85 near Atlanta caused a major traffic disruption earlier today. According to reports, multiple southbound lanes were blocked by the incident, creating significant backup for afternoon commuters traveling through the corridor. The exact time of the incident and number of vehicles involved were not immediately detailed in initial reports.
Responding agencies worked to clear the scene and restore traffic flow. Southbound lanes have now reopened, and traffic has returned to normal conditions. Early reports on the incident remain incomplete, and additional details may emerge as authorities complete their assessment of the scene.
